Position Summary:
We’re seeking a highly analytical and detail-oriented Cost Analyst II / Inventory Specialist to join a reputable manufacturing company in Tucson. This is a full-time, direct hire opportunity where you'll play a vital role in driving cost-efficiency and accuracy in inventory management for a growing organization.
What You’ll Do:
Analyze product and production costs, providing insights to optimize operational expenses
Monitor and reconcile inventory transactions, discrepancies, and variances
Support month-end closing activities related to inventory and cost accounting
Collaborate with manufacturing and supply chain teams to improve inventory accuracy
Maintain and improve cost standards and reporting systems
Assist in forecasting, budgeting, and financial planning related to materials and production
Ideal Candidate Has:
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field
2–5 years of experience in cost analysis, inventory control, or manufacturing finance
Strong Excel and ERP/MRP system proficiency
Experience in a manufacturing or production environment
Detail-driven, analytical mindset with strong communication skills
Ability to work independently in a fast-paced, onsite environment
